Prep Time and Servings

  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 30-35 minutes
  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Servings: 12

Ingredients

For the Crust and Topping:

  • 2 cans of crescent roll dough
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, melted

For the Cheesecake Filling:

  • 2 packages (8 oz each) cream cheese, softened
  • ¾ c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 large egg

Instructions

Step 1: Preheat and Prepare the Baking Dish

Preheat your oven to 175°C (350°F).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ish with butter or non-stick spray to prevent sticking.

Step 2: Mix the Cinnamon Sugar

In a small bowl, combine the sugar and cinnamon. Set aside half of this mixture for later use.

Step 3: Create the Bottom Crust

Unroll one can of crescent roll dough and press it evenly into the bottom of the greased baking dish. Pinch any seams together to create a smooth layer. Sprinkle half of the prepared cinnamon sugar mixture over the dough.

Step 4: Make the Cheesecake Filling

In a m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ese, sugar, vanilla extract, and egg until smooth and creamy. Spread this mixture evenly over the dough in the baking dish.

Step 5: Add the Top Layer

Unroll the second can of crescent roll dough and gently place it over the cheesecake filling. Try to cover the entire surface and pinch the seams together.

Step 6: Add Topping and Bake

Pour the melted butter evenly over the top layer of dough. Sprinkle the remaining cinnamon sugar mixture generously on top.

Bake for 30-35 minutes or until the top is golden brown and slightly crisp.

Step 7: Cool and Serve

Let the churro cheesecake cool for at least 15 minutes before slicing. For best results, refrigerate for an hour to allow the layers to set completely. Cut into squares and enjoy!

Tips for the Best Churro Cheesecake

  • Use full-fat cream cheese for a richer filling.
  • Let the cheesecake cool completely before cutting to prevent it from falling apart.
  • Serve with caramel or chocolate drizzle for extra indulgence.
